How to create a product catalog using V-Ray for Rhino and Chaos Cloud?

The purpose of this article is to provide you with a clear guide on how to automate a typical scenario that product designers often face: creating a product catalog.

Imagine you've poured your heart and soul into your work to create a beautiful collection of modern furniture — and you win the project! The client now wants you to create all the images for their online shop and print catalog; that’s five views of each product — front, back, left, right, and top — and in HD resolution. Need more convincing? Here is a brief overview of what's included in Ivan’s step-by-step guide:

Step 1: Set up your models as V-Ray scenes

Create a simple scene for each one of the products on a white background, or as needed for your catalog, and then export it as a .vrscene. You only need to create one scene for each product. Unfortunately, we cannot automate the design process for you, but this guide shows how to automate everything else you need to do to create multiple views of a product, and then render them in various resolutions.

Step 2: Create the required views of your products – automatically

Based on your specific catalog and creative needs, set up all views (front, back, left, right, top) of just one of the products that you want to include in your catalog. We've created a script that uses those sample views to automatically generate all the necessary views for all products from your catalog. The script will work correctly for all products about the same size. For example, views created for just one of your chairs will work for all of your chairs, armchairs, bedside tables, and so on.

Step 3: Submit auto-generated scenes to Chaos Cloud – with one command

Now that you have generated all the views of all of your products automatically, it is time to render them. This process can be automated, thanks to Chaos Cloud's command-line interface. You don't need need to be a programmer to do it — we've included the script with the guidе — just copy and paste it. You can also use the script to render both the thumbnails that you'll need for your website catalog and the full-size images. Once the render jobs are complete, just hit Enter and all the images will download into the respective folders.
